Irinotecan in Treating Aging Patients With Solid Tumors
RATIONALE: Drugs used in chemotherapy use different ways to stop tumor cells from dividing so they stop growing or die. Aging may affect the way these drugs work.
PURPOSE: Phase I trial to determine the relationship between aging and the effectiveness of irinotecan in treating patients who have solid tumors.

About this study
OBJECTIVES:
- Determine whether there is a relationship between the pharmacokinetic characteristics of irinotecan and aging in patients with non-hematologic malignancies.
- Determine whether there is a relationship between the toxic effects of this drug and aging in these patients.
- Determine whether the relationship between genotype (UGT1A1, CYP3A, and other relevant genes) and phenotype (pharmacokinetics, toxicity) is affected by aging in these patients treated with this drug.
- Analyze data collected on the co-morbid conditions and concurrent medications in these patients treated with this drug.
OUTLINE: This is a multicenter study. Patients are stratified according to age (18 to 55 vs 70 and over).
Patients receive irinotecan IV over 90 minutes once weekly for 4 weeks. Treatment continues in the absence of disease progression or unacceptable toxicity.
Patients are followed for survival.
PROJECTED ACCRUAL: A total of 140 patients (70 per stratum) will be accrued for this study within 3.5 years.

DISEASE CHARACTERISTICS:
- Histologically confirmed non-hematologic malignancy
- Brain metastases or primary brain tumors are eligible provided patient is not receiving steroids or antiepileptic medications
PATIENT CHARACTERISTICS:
Age:
- 18 to 55 or 70 and over
Performance status:
- CTC 0-2
Life expectancy:
- Not specified
Hematopoietic:
- Granulocyte count at least 1,500/mm^3
- Platelet count at least 100,000/mm^3
Hepatic:
- Bilirubin no greater than upper limit of normal (ULN)
- SGOT no greater than ULN
Renal:
- Creatinine no greater than ULN
Other:
- Not pregnant or nursing
- Fertile patients must use effective contraception
PRIOR CONCURRENT THERAPY:
Biologic therapy:
- Not specified
Chemotherapy:
- At least 4 weeks since prior chemotherapy (6 weeks for nitrosourea)
- No more than 1 prior chemotherapy regimen for metastatic disease (no limit if administered in the adjuvant setting)
- No prior camptothecin
Endocrine therapy:
- See Disease Characteristics
Radiotherapy:
- At least 4 weeks since prior radiotherapy
- No concurrent radiotherapy, including for palliation
Surgery:
- At least 4 weeks since prior major surgery
